The Ministry of Culture (MiCultura), together with the Embassy of Japan in Panama, celebrated the 120 anniversary of the establishment of diplomatic relations between Japan and Panama with the first presentation of the Kabuki Theater, a traditional Japanese stage art recognized as an Intangible Cultural Heritage of the UNESCO.

That activity, held free of charge at the Theater Festival, was a cultural and educational program that included a demonstration of Kabiki dance without makeup and with simple costumes, a workshop of makeup and costumes with explanations, and the heroic dance of the Lion.

The guest actor, Ukon Onoe, an emerging star in the Kabuki world, was the protagonist of this unusual performance, which combined dance, theater and music with his unique costumes and makeup.

María Eugenia Herrera, Minister of Culture, emphasized that "throughout more than a century our nations have built strong bonds with mutual respect, cultural understanding and cooperation. Japan has been an ally and an invaluable friend to Panama."

He added "today we pay tribute to this profound relationship of friendship, recognizing the roots that both countries have sown in fields such as culture, education and economic development."

"That art should continue to be a tool for strengthening our relations and building bridges among our nations," added Herrera.

For his part Hideo Fukushima, Ambassador of the Republic of Japan to the Republic of Panama, expressed "we are pleased to celebrate these 120 years of friendship among our countries I wish that relations continue to develop in a prosperous and true manner."
